New ODOT Building Planned for Bend

The Oregon Department of Transportation (ODOT) plans to build a new facility in Bend. It will house about 76 employees from ODOT's Highway Project delivery staff. The two-story 20,000 square foot building along Third Street, south of Empire, will put these workers under one roof. The year long construction project will start this summer and bring dozens of construction jobs to the area. ODOT is still determining the feasibility of renovating the old Welcome Center Building to become the permanent location for the DMV Office in Bend. They plan to hold public meetings on the subject in the future.
